May 2025 - Apr 2026Clarendon Road area has the 30th lowest crime rate of 92 local areas in Forest , and the 241st lowest crime rate of 687 local areas in Waltham Forest .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Clarendon Road (E17 9AZ) in the last 12 months was 55.8 per 1,000 residents and was 43.7% lower than the Forest average (99.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 5 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 400.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 8 (β 17.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 60.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-57.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Clarendon Road (E17 9AZ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near High Road, where police recorded 149 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Stanley Road (41 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
